英文摘要The unit area value-based method has been widely used in ecosystem service value assessment research. This method assumes that the area of landscape elements and their ecosystem service values are linearly related. However, the landscape pattern will have a greater impact on the ecosystem services of the whole landscape. This research proposes the concept of "extra services" and takes the Costal Bench Terrace System, which is a potential agricultural heritage system, as the research object. We evaluated the ecosystem services value of its landscape elements and the ecosystem service value of the whole landscape to judge whether there were extra services in the agricultural landscape. The results show the following: (1) The total ecosystem service value of the Costal Bench Terrace System was 1.512 billion CNY.1 (2) The ecosystem service value of farmland ecosystems was 603 million CNY. The ecosystem service value of aquatic ecosystems was 826 million CNY. (3) There are extra services in the Costal Bench Terrace System. Its value was 83 million CNY, accounting for 5.5% of the total value. The research shows that the ecosystem service value of landscape elements and the area of landscape elements may not be purely linear, and these results can provide a reference for landscape ecosystem service value evaluation research.
